Responsibilities
- Handle daily processing of trades and ensures on-time settlement of all trades (Equity, Bonds, Crypto).
- Liaise with counterparties, custodians for any trades mismatch, failure / issues to ensure fast and effective resolution.
- Ensures timely and no unaccountable reconciliation breaks for cash, securities and other GL accounts / unclaimed fund items.
- Conduct end-of-day control checks in processing system and SWIFT Alliance queue to make sure that there are no trades left unattended and unprocessed.
- Ensures full compliance to all policies and regulations including SFA's T+X+1. Complete adherence to SLAs with Wealth Business and other internal and external customers.
- On-time escalation of issues and risks to the Team leader or to the Area Manager.
- Diploma / Degree in Banking, Business Studies or other related course of studies.
- At least 2 - 3 years experience in a Private Banking and/or Wealth Management Operations.
- Knowledge in Investment products (i.e. Equities/Bonds/Crypto).
- Functional knowledge/experience in back office support is required.
- Good team player, able to multi-task, self motivated with good interpersonal skill.
- Able to take on new tasks as and when required by the business and/or management.
- Meticulous, focused, alert with an eye for figures and details.
- Good knowledge of MS Office applications especially MS Word and MS Excel.
